2.3—Staff Plan

This process element creates the Staff Plan that facilitates specifying, acquiring, and assigning the resources needed to conduct the project. It includes preparing a staff responsibility matrix and managing team formation to fulfill resource requirements. It also provides the mechanism, a resource request form, to expedite the resource acquisition process when resource managers external to the project are involved in contributing resources to the project effort. The Staff Plan also allows the project manager or other responsible individual to maintain relevant project team member information and to track individual assignments and performance.

schedule/timing

The Staff Plan can be created in conjunction with the Project Work Plan, and finalized with the completed development of the project WBS. The Staff Plan in general may be prepared simultaneously with other project plan components.

process steps and toolkit reference

The following four process steps will be accomplished to create the Staff Plan.

2.3.1—staff requirementsIdentify and describe the staff positions needed to perform this project. Specify the type or category of resources needed and the activity they will perform. List the staff roles according to position title/technical discipline (e.g., engineer II, developer I, etc.). List vendor for work activities expected to be outsourced.

2.3.2—staff management planReview customer and staff requirements to prepare guidance for project team formation and management during the project. This will include specifying group and individual development actions that make the team a cohesive unit.Specify the individual who will be responsible for staff management plan management.

2.3.3—staff acquisition—Compile, monitor and manage information that is used to request project staff members and to oversee the staff acquisition and development process. Identify project staffing needs, prepare the acquisition request, and track acquisition of staff resources.

2.3.4—staff assignments Compile, monitor and manage information that is relevant to assigning and managing individual project team members. Track individual project task assignments and associated work performance.Annotate leadership and task specialty assignments.

The project manager leads the project planning team (or adjunct project team) in developing the resource requirements matrix to identify staffing needs, and assigns project planning team members (or adjunct project team members) to prepare the associated Staff Management Plan. The project manager also oversees preparation of resource acquisition requests that are sent to and collaborated with internal resource managers. Resource managers’ commitments of resources are tracked, and in some cases it will be necessary for the project manager to collaborate or even negotiate for resource time with individual resource managers. As resources are assigned to the project, the project manager and key assistants will work with the growing project team to develop its capability and cohesiveness. In turn, individual assignments and performance will be tracked and managed under this Staff Plan.

process output (project management deliverable)

The primary output of this process element is the documentation and review of a Staff Management Plan. This plan includes a resource responsibility matrix, and the means to track and manage resource acquisition and project assignment performance.
